A Infor Case Study
Rip Curl, the Australian surf-wear brand headquartered in Torquay (AU $500M revenue, 3,000+ employees), still manufactures its iconic wetsuits in-house but faced a rapidly changing market as local surf shops gave way to flagship stores and ecommerce grew. The company needed a more agile, secure platform to integrate global supply-chain and business processes, gain real-time visibility, and capture economies of scale across retail, wholesale and manufacturing.
Rip Curl moved progressively to Infor CloudSuite Fashion—using its US operation as a test case—upgrading core ERP, peripheral applications and interfaces to a cloud-based, adaptive platform. The rollout delivered faster, real-time processes and clearer value-chain visibility, enabled easier collaboration with third-party warehouses, automated customer interfaces, eliminated manual processing, and established a foundation for uniform global business processing and improved customer service.
